Originally published in 1953 with the sub-title A Story of Undersea Discovery and Adventure, by the First Men to Swim at Record Depths with the Freedom of Fish, Silent World recounts Cousteau's earliest days of scuba diving, using an aqua lung which allowed for the first time untethered, deep water diving; later chapters concern diving to shipwrecks.ย  The book was the basis for the 1956 academy award winning documentary film of the same name.
